Output 7f868fc13a76b34875e02c9436b9804990deb1581c5772461d63b45f5705347e:0

value
568889552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4589aff0bbb6c34d760f98d6be55b939a3cda2cf OP_EQUAL
address
382hVTac9LHnkFJ5KqM3morGivYM4HEJzu
transaction
7f868fc13a76b34875e02c9436b9804990deb1581c5772461d63b45f5705347e
spent
true